Are Mikimoto pearls still valuable?

Yes, Mikimoto pearls are still valuable and continue to be valuable after purchase. In fact, depending on their condition and grade, Mikimoto pearls can increase in value over time. For example, larger AAA-grade pearls with good provenance have been known to be a high-value find at some auctions.

Is Mikimoto a luxury brand?

Yes, Mikimoto is a luxury brand known for its specialization and expertise in creating pearl jewelry from Akoya pearls. The world-renowned brand was first established in 1893.

How can you tell if Mikimoto is real?

If you’re trying to determine the authenticity of a Mikimoto bracelet or accessory, be sure to look for their trademark on the piece, which is either the outline of an oyster or an engraving of the Mikimoto name. 

Is Akoya the same as Mikimoto?

No, Akoya and Mikimoto are not synonymous. Akoya is the type of pearl that the Mikimoto brand has become famous for selling.
